Apostle Suleman Begs Buhari Over Flight Ban From Nigeria To Dubai
TRIXX NG reports that popular man of God, Apostle Johnson Suleman has pleaded with Federal government over a recent communique sent by the United Arab Emirates on the conditions to lift ban on flight from Nigeria into the country and vice versa.
The UAE had given some conditions yesterday on lifting the ban, and they stated that only 200 passengers will be flown in every two weeks.
The federal government is yet to react to this, the man of God made it known that so many people are stranded and need to return to their homes
The Nigeria govt should pls hearken to the UAE's recent communique and dialogue with them so this temporal flight ban can be lifted..
There are so many Nigerians stranded there and need to return home..— Apst Johnson Suleman (@APOSTLESULEMAN) March 27, 2021
